Welcome to the forums, thanks for registering and taking the time to post a question. As far as the backfiring, that could be a number of things. Timing could be off, too hot or cold of a spark plug, jetting, or even a dirty filter or jetting that doesn't match the airflow. It sounds like its running a little lean.
